aerodynamics affects a car due to the force of drag. as you drive the car, you excerpt a force in one direction. since the air is a fluid, is excerpts and equal and opposite force on the car. you can overcome this force by changing the shape of the car to allow the air to flow over it more smoothly, thus reducing the drag.

its similar to dragging your hand through water. if you drag your hand with your palm perpendicular to the direction of motion, you'll experience more drag then if you dragged your hand with your palm parallel to the motion.

List all the factors that affect car speed?

Weight of vehicle. Aerodynamics of vehicle. Horsepower & torque of engine. Gearing of vehicle. Headwind or tailwind. Elevation above sea level. Type of fuel used. Terrain. Tires. Outside temperature. Weather.
